From 4b4f50352d061c569fe448e72aaa47ee54d138bc Mon Sep 17 00:00:00 2001 From: wukong Date: Sun, 14 Oct 2018 16:00:25 -0700 Subject: restructured conditional prints in diff, added parabolic focus solution to quad_reg output --- diff.awk | 8 ++------ 1 file changed, 2 insertions(+), 6 deletions(-) (limited to 'diff.awk') diff --git a/diff.awk b/diff.awk index 3bb58c0..721aac6 100644 --- a/diff.awk +++ b/diff.awk @@ -30,10 +30,8 @@ NR == 1 { ### diff columns for (n=1; n<=NF; n++) { printf(dheader[n]) - if (n < NF) - printf(OFS) + printf(n < NF ? OFS : ORS) } - printf(ORS) } NF { @@ -63,8 +61,6 @@ NF { } else diff[y] = "" - if (y < nf_max) - printf(OFS) + printf(y < nf_max ? OFS : ORS) } - printf(ORS) } -- cgit v1.2.3